If a ball mill uses little or no water during grinding, it is a dry mill. If a ball mill uses water during grinding, it is a wet mill. A typical ball mill will have a drum length that is 1 or 1.5 times the drum diameter. Ball mills with a drum length to diameter ratio greater than 1.5 are referred to as tube mills. Nov 06, 2019 To help the grinding process, water and steel balls are added to the process which then form the charge in the mill. Ball mill charge contains a significant amount of steel balls and can become extremely heavy. For example, a large 24 foot 7.3 m diameter ball mill charge typically weighs around 2 million lbs 907 tons.

Charging a Wet Mill The general operation of a grinding mill is to have the product impacted between the balls as they tumble. Unlike dry milling, wet milling is more straight forward and more forgiving in terms of charging the product. As with dry milling there should be at least 25 liquid to fill the void space plus a bit more to insure ...

8.3.2.2 Ball mills. The ball mill is a tumbling mill that uses steel balls as the grinding media. The length of the cylindrical shell is usually 11.5 times the shell diameter Figure 8.11. The feed can be dry, with less than 3 moisture to minimize ball coating, or slurry containing 2040 water by weight.
